About the Role

We are looking for an enthusiastic and hands‑on Junior / Trainee Service Engineer to join our growing Gas Detection and Instrumentation team. This is an excellent opportunity for someone looking to start or develop a career in the instrumentation, electrical, or engineering field. You’ll receive full training to become proficient in the installation, calibration, maintenance, and servicing of fixed and portable gas detection systems and other instrumentation used across industrial and commercial environments.

Key Responsibilities
  • Initially assist senior engineers with the installation, Calibration, commissioning, and servicing of gas detection and instrumentation systems.
  • Learn to carry out calibration, testing, and fault‑finding under supervision.
  • Support the completion of service reports and documentation.
  • Develop technical knowledge of sensors, transmitters, control systems, and detection technologies.
  • Follow company and client health & safety procedures at all times.
  • Ultimately working on solo service visits for installation, Calibration, commissioning, and servicing of gas detection and instrumentation systems.
  • Provide excellent customer service while representing the company on‑site.
  • Support the wider business and be flexible enough to undertake other activities to support a growing small business.
